cad的坐标高程怎么提取到excel

cad的坐标高程怎么提取到excel

CAD的坐标高程怎么提取到Excel?
要将CAD中的坐标高程提取到Excel,可以使用以下方法:使用AutoCAD内置的命令、使用LISP程序、使用第三方插件。其中,使用AutoCAD内置的命令是最直观和常用的方法,通过AutoCAD的“Data Extraction”工具,用户可以直接将坐标和高程数据提取并导出到Excel。

一、使用AutoCAD内置的命令

AutoCAD提供了多种工具和命令,可以将绘图中的数据提取出来。最常用的工具是“Data Extraction”,该工具可以帮助用户从绘图中提取坐标、属性等数据并导出到Excel。

1.1、启动Data Extraction工具

  1. 打开AutoCAD。
  2. 在命令行输入DATAEXTRACTION,按下回车键。
  3. 在弹出的对话框中,选择“创建新的数据提取”。
  4. 选择保存数据提取文件的路径和文件名,然后点击“下一步”。

1.2、选择要提取的对象

  1. 在“选择图纸和图纸集”页面,点击“添加图纸”,选择包含要提取坐标高程的图纸。
  2. 点击“下一步”,进入“选择对象”页面。
  3. 在此页面,选择要提取数据的对象类型(例如点、块等),然后点击“下一步”。

1.3、选择要提取的属性

  1. 在“选择属性”页面,勾选“位置(X、Y、Z)”属性。
  2. 点击“下一步”,进入“组织和排序”页面。
  3. 在此页面,可以对提取的数据进行排序和过滤,然后点击“下一步”。

1.4、导出数据到Excel

  1. 在“完成”页面,选择“输出数据到外部文件”。
  2. 选择文件类型为“Excel(*.xls)”,然后点击“下一步”。
  3. 指定Excel文件的保存路径和文件名,然后点击“完成”。

二、使用LISP程序

LISP是一种编程语言,可以在AutoCAD中编写脚本来实现特定的功能。通过编写LISP程序,可以自动提取坐标高程并导出到Excel。

2.1、编写LISP程序

以下是一个简单的LISP程序示例,用于提取图纸中所有点的坐标高程:

(defun c:ExtractCoordinatesToExcel (/ ss i en pt file)

(setq ss (ssget '((0 . "POINT")))) ; 选择所有点对象

(setq file (open "C:/coordinates.csv" "w")) ; 打开CSV文件

(if ss

(progn

(setq i 0)

(repeat (sslength ss)

(setq en (ssname ss i))

(setq pt (cdr (assoc 10 (entget en))))

(write-line (strcat (rtos (car pt) 2 3) "," (rtos (cadr pt) 2 3) "," (rtos (caddr pt) 2 3)) file)

(setq i (1+ i))

)

)

)

(close file)

(princ)

)

2.2、加载和运行LISP程序

  1. 在AutoCAD中,输入命令APPLOAD,加载上述LISP程序。
  2. 输入命令ExtractCoordinatesToExcel,运行程序。
  3. 程序将会在指定路径生成一个CSV文件,包含所有点的坐标高程。

三、使用第三方插件

除了AutoCAD内置的工具和LISP程序外,还有许多第三方插件可以帮助用户提取坐标高程并导出到Excel。这些插件通常具有更强大的功能和更友好的用户界面。

3.1、安装插件

  1. 选择一个适合的第三方插件,例如“CADtoExcel”。
  2. 下载并安装插件,按照安装向导完成安装。

3.2、使用插件提取数据

  1. 打开AutoCAD并加载插件。
  2. 根据插件的使用说明,选择要提取的对象和属性。
  3. 将提取的数据导出到Excel。

四、总结

将CAD中的坐标高程提取到Excel有多种方法,每种方法都有其优缺点。使用AutoCAD内置的命令是最直观和常用的方法,通过“Data Extraction”工具,可以轻松提取并导出数据。使用LISP程序则适用于需要自动化处理大量数据的场景,通过编写脚本,可以实现更灵活的数据提取和导出。使用第三方插件则提供了更强大的功能和更友好的用户界面,适合需要高级功能的用户。

无论选择哪种方法,都需要根据实际需求和场景进行选择。掌握这些方法,可以大大提高工作效率,使得CAD中的数据可以更方便地进行分析和处理。

相关问答FAQs:

1. 如何将CAD中的坐标高程提取到Excel中?

  • 问题: 我想将CAD图纸中的坐标高程数据导入到Excel中,应该如何操作?
  • 回答: 您可以使用CAD软件中的数据提取工具将坐标高程数据提取到Excel中。首先,在CAD软件中打开相应的图纸,然后找到数据提取工具,通常可以在工具栏或菜单栏中找到。接下来,选择要提取的坐标高程数据,并指定导出为Excel格式。点击导出按钮后,您将得到一个包含坐标高程数据的Excel文件。

2. 如何在CAD中导出坐标高程至Excel?

  • 问题: 我希望将CAD图纸中的坐标高程导出到Excel,方便进行数据分析,应该如何操作?
  • 回答: 要在CAD中导出坐标高程至Excel,您可以使用CAD软件中的导出功能。首先,打开您的CAD图纸,然后选择要导出的坐标高程数据。接下来,找到导出选项,通常可以在文件菜单或导出工具中找到。选择导出为Excel格式,并指定导出的文件路径和名称。点击导出按钮后,您将获得一个包含坐标高程数据的Excel文件。

3. 如何从CAD图纸中提取坐标高程并保存为Excel文件?

  • 问题: 我需要从CAD图纸中提取坐标高程数据,并将其保存为Excel文件以便进一步分析,应该如何操作?
  • 回答: 要从CAD图纸中提取坐标高程并保存为Excel文件,您可以使用CAD软件中的数据提取功能。首先,打开您的CAD图纸,然后找到数据提取工具,通常可以在工具栏或菜单栏中找到。选择要提取的坐标高程数据,并指定导出为Excel格式。点击提取按钮后,您将得到一个包含坐标高程数据的Excel文件,可以保存在您选择的位置。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4407559

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部